Description of kickscrew.com
Kickscrew.com appears to be an online shopping website focused on sneakers, athletic footwear, and related lifestyle products. Based on the domain name, page layout, and classification data, the site functions as a retail marketplace for branded shoes and apparel, with navigation for major sportswear labels such as Nike, Adidas, New Balance, Asics, and Jordan.
The homepage screenshot shows a polished e-commerce storefront with product listings, pricing, category navigation, and promotional banners. The domain has been registered since 2009, which suggests it is a long-established commercial website rather than a newly created storefront. Based on available data, it appears to operate as a mainstream online retail platform in the shopping and lifestyle space.
Safety Assessment for kickscrew.com
The scan results are broadly reassuring at the time of this scan. The domain was not flagged by any of 91 security engines, the malware scan reported no flagged files, and the checked threat-database and blacklist sources did not indicate phishing, malware, or other content-based threats. Multiple web-classification providers also categorize the site as online shopping or retail, which is consistent with the visible storefront content.
Additional context also supports a lower-risk assessment. The domain is more than 16 years old, has a measurable traffic presence, and the screenshot shows a functioning retail site rather than a parked page, error page, or obvious impersonation setup. The visible product pricing does not show the kind of extreme discounting often associated with fraudulent stores, and no suspicious external links or iframes were reported in the scan.
Based on available data, no threats were detected at the time of this scan.
Technical Description
The site is using a valid SSL/TLS certificate issued by a major certificate provider, with expiry listed in 2026. It is served through Cloudflare infrastructure, with Cloudflare nameservers and a Cloudflare-hosted web server IP, which may provide CDN and security-layer benefits such as traffic filtering and performance optimization.
DNSSEC appears to be unsigned, which is not uncommon but means DNS responses may not benefit from that additional integrity layer. No major technical security concerns were indicated in the provided scan data, and the domain's long registration history and stable infrastructure are generally consistent with an established commercial website.
